Transaction a5406ec3600ab31001027f8701f26251e3aee513b510345b1ce32bede4569361
1 Input
1 Output
-
a5406ec3600ab31001027f8701f26251e3aee513b510345b1ce32bede4569361:0
- value
- 10307950
- script pubkey
- OP_0 OP_PUSHBYTES_20 95a3a907ba5888eb9157870e4e627ef49bc7429a
- address
- ltc1qjk36jpa6tzywhy2hsu8yucn77jduws56pju4m7